α-5 Laminin Synthesized by Human Pluripotent Stem Cells Promotes Self-Renewal
Substrate composition significantly impacts human pluripotent stem cell (hPSC) self-renewal and differentiation, but relatively little is known about the role of endogenously produced extracellular matrix (ECM) components in regulating hPSC fates.
